Thought I'd post part sources for 351C engines (and others)
NAPA sells a quality thermostat housing (nice and thick base machined flat) p/n 605-1053
and 5/8" press in heater hose fittings 660-1580
The cleveland is supposed to have a special thermostat that covers up the hole in the orifice plate under it.....the thermostat's copper bulb moves downward and has a "hat" on it that makes it the right diameter. I picked a pair of stant thermostats up from a pantera place in reno.
I dont have a part number, but at least stant makes them...I got 180 degree models.
